Sending Data Programmatically to Final Cut Pro Manage and streamline the sending of batches of media assets and timeline sequences from your app using Apple events.

Overview

Consider using Apple events to help your users manage their workflow if they have many assets to send to Final Cut Pro and generally send all of those assets before starting their work in Final Cut Pro. With Apple event support in your app, your users need fewer clicks to send their media assets, projects, and metadata to Final Cut Pro for editing.

To provide a more streamlined process, use the Open Document Apple event to send an FCPXML document to Final Cut Pro and trigger the process with a button or menu item in your app.
